Sutil, di Resta eye better teams for 2014

Seven races into the 2013 season, neither Paul di Resta nor Adrian Sutil are committing their futures to Force India. The Silverstone based team has impressed the paddock with its Toro Rosso, Sauber, Williams and even McLaren-beating car this year. But German Sutil, who returned to F1 with Force India in 2013 after a forced sabbatical, admitted he is eyeing the newly-vacant seat at Red Bull. "Many drivers would like to race for that team," he is quoted by Germany's Auto Motor und Sport. "I would be delighted if they want to take my services.
